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| remove apply_finder_options call from AssociationScope | Jon Leighton | 2012-04-13 | 1 | -7/+8 |
| | |||||
* | Revert "only mutate the scope object in the `bind` method" | Aaron Patterson | 2012-02-27 | 1 | -1/+1 |
| | | | | This reverts commit 1b9e19cd22f2b5d5e7b82e042f92340822c0f966. | ||||
* | only mutate the scope object in the `bind` method | Aaron Patterson | 2012-02-27 | 1 | -1/+1 |
| | |||||
* | bind value creation refactoring | Aaron Patterson | 2012-02-27 | 1 | -4/+10 |
| | |||||
* | removing dead code | Aaron Patterson | 2012-02-27 | 1 | -3/+2 |
| | |||||
* | use bind values for join columns | Aaron Patterson | 2012-02-27 | 1 | -1/+16 |
| | |||||
* | fix associations when using per class databases | Lars Kanis | 2012-02-10 | 1 | -1/+1 |
| | | | | | | would get ConnectionNotEstablished error because it always tried to use ActiveRecord::Base's connection, even though it should be using the connection of the model whose context we're operating in | ||||
* | Deprecate inferred JOINs with includes + SQL snippets. | Jon Leighton | 2012-01-16 | 1 | -1/+1 |
| | | | | | | See the CHANGELOG for details. Fixes #950. | ||||
* | Avoid sanitize_sql when we can use Relation#where instead | Jon Leighton | 2012-01-16 | 1 | -2/+5 |
| | |||||
* | Revert "Deprecate implicit eager loading. Closes #950." | Jon Leighton | 2012-01-16 | 1 | -1/+1 |
| | | | | This reverts commit c99d507fccca2e9e4d12e49b4387e007c5481ae9. | ||||
* | Remove Array.wrap calls in ActiveRecord | Rafael Mendonça França | 2012-01-06 | 1 | -1/+1 |
| | |||||
* | Deprecate implicit eager loading. Closes #950. | Jon Leighton | 2011-12-29 | 1 | -1/+1 |
| | |||||
* | Use uniq instead of manually putting a DISTINCT in the query | Jon Leighton | 2011-11-05 | 1 | -14/+2 |
| | |||||
* | Merge pull request #3030 from htanata/fix_habtm_select_query_method | Jon Leighton | 2011-09-26 | 1 | -4/+0 |
| | | | | Fix: habtm doesn't respect select query method | ||||
* | Fix belongs_to polymorphic with custom primary key on target. | Jon Leighton | 2011-09-26 | 1 | -1/+6 |
| | | | | Closes #3104. | ||||
* | use association_primary_key in AssociationScope#add_constraints | Marian Rudzynski | 2011-05-26 | 1 | -1/+1 |
| | |||||
* | Fix problem with loading polymorphic associations which have been defined in ↵ | Jon Leighton | 2011-05-22 | 1 | -5/+15 |
| | | | | an abstract superclass. Fixes #552. | ||||
* | Fix tests under postgres - we should always put conditions in the WHERE part ↵ | Jon Leighton | 2011-03-12 | 1 | -5/+8 |
| | | | | not in ON constraints because postgres requires that the table has been joined before the condition references it. | ||||
* | Abstract some common code from AssociationScope and ↵ | Jon Leighton | 2011-03-11 | 1 | -44/+12 |
| | | | | JoinDependency::JoinAssociation into a JoinHelper module | ||||
* | Rename Reflection#through_reflection_chain and #through_options to ↵ | Jon Leighton | 2011-03-10 | 1 | -6/+6 |
| | | | | Reflection#chain and Reflection#options as they now no longer relate solely to through associations. | ||||
* | Move the code which builds a scope for through associations into a generic ↵ | Jon Leighton | 2011-03-10 | 1 | -0/+149 |
AssociationScope class which is capable of building a scope for any association. |